This week on the podcast, Patrick and Tracy welcome Mark Stevens, author of No Lie Lasts Forever.
About No Lie Lasts Forever: When a reporter dies in a shockingly familiar way, the media rushes to announce the return of the PDQ Killer. The city of Denver reels, but no one more than Harry Kugel. After all, he is the PDQ Killer – or was fifteen years ago. And he didn’t do this.
Still working to reform his ways, Harry won’t let some amateur murderer ride his twisted coattails and risk drawing the police back his way. To protect his legacy and quiet new life, he’ll have to expose the copycat. Without exposing himself.
Disgraced TV journalist Flynn Martin holds the key. After a botched hostage situation, she’ll do anything to revive her dying career – even hunt down a monster who executed one of her own.
Harry must convince Flynn to follow him into the heady world of a killer. But with the law closing in and a rival at large, he starts to feel the familiar pull of old urges…
About Mark Stevens: Mark Stevens is the author of No Lie Lasts Forever (June 2025 from Thomas & Mercer), The Fireballer (Lake Union, 2023), and The Allison Coil Mystery Series including Antler Dust, Buried by the Roan, Trapline, Lake of Fire, and The Melancholy Howl.
Buried by the Roan, Trapline, and Lake of Fire were all finalists for the Colorado Book Award. Trapline won.
Stevens has had short stories published by Ellery Queen Mystery Magazine, Mystery Tribune, and in Denver Noir (Akashic Books, 2022). Denver Noir went on to win the Colorado Book Award for Best Anthology in 2023.
In 2016 and again in 2023, Stevens was named Rocky Mountain Fiction Writers’ Writer of the Year.
Stevens hosted a regular podcast for Rocky Mountain Fiction Writers for ten years.
Stevens has served as president of the Rocky Mountain chapter for Mystery Writers of America. Stevens also regularly publishes reviews on his review website.
Today, Stevens lives in Mancos, Colorado.
